云服务器与数据库配置,如何优化性能与稳定性?,优化云服务器与数据库配置以提升性能与稳定性指南

admin 国内云服务器 2025-03-18 16 0
云服务器与数据库配置是确保应用程序性能和稳定性的关键。应定期监控系统资源使用情况,以便及时调整配置。根据实际需求合理分配CPU、内存和存储资源,以满足应用性能要求。利用负载均衡技术分散请求压力,提高系统吞吐量。优化数据库查询语句和索引,减少不必要的资源消耗。实施备份恢复策略,确保数据安全。通过这些措施,可以显著提升云服务器与数据库的配置性能和稳定性。

随着云计算技术的广泛应用,云服务器和数据库已经成为现代应用架构中不可或缺的组成部分,云服务器以其弹性伸缩、按需付费的特性,为开发者提供了灵活且高效的计算资源;而数据库则是存储和管理数据的关键工具,在实际应用中,云服务器和数据库的性能与稳定性常常成为制约应用效果的关键因素,本文将深入探讨云服务器与数据库配置中的优化策略,以提升整体应用的性能与稳定性。

二、云服务器配置优化

云服务器的性能优化主要体现在以下几个方面:

(一)选择合适的云服务提供商与实例类型

不同的云服务提供商提供不同类型的云服务器实例,如计算优化型、内存优化型、存储优化型等,选择适合应用需求的实例类型至关重要,对于需要高并发处理能力的应用,应选择计算优化型实例;而对于存储大量文件的应用,则应选择具有高存储密度的实例。

(二)合理配置CPU与内存

云服务器的CPU和内存配置直接影响其处理能力,配置过低的CPU或内存会导致应用响应缓慢,甚至出现宕机;而配置过高则可能造成资源浪费,应根据应用的实际需求进行合理的配置,利用云服务商提供的自动扩展功能,根据负载情况动态调整资源配置,也是优化性能的有效手段。

(三)网络配置优化

网络延迟和带宽限制是影响云服务器性能的重要因素,优化网络配置包括设置合理的VPC(虚拟私有云)范围、使用高速网络连接以及启用CDN(内容分发网络)等,这些措施可以有效降低网络延迟,提高数据传输速度,从而提升应用的整体性能。

(四)安全组与防火墙配置

合理的安全组规则和防火墙配置能够保护云服务器免受网络攻击,确保应用的稳定运行,配置安全组时,应根据应用的实际需求设定允许的访问端口和协议类型;定期检查和更新防火墙规则,以应对潜在的安全威胁。

三、数据库配置优化

数据库的性能优化涉及多个方面,以下是一些关键策略:

(一)数据库硬件选择

高性能的数据库硬件是保证数据库快速运行的基础,选择具有足够内存、高速磁盘接口(如SSD)和高主频的服务器或云服务,能够显著提升数据库的性能,合理规划数据库集群的硬件配置,以实现负载均衡和故障恢复。

(二)合理设计数据库架构

数据库架构的设计对性能有很大影响,合理的数据库架构应该能够支持高效的数据查询、插入、更新和删除操作,通过合理设计表结构、索引和分区策略,可以大大提高数据库的处理效率,避免过度规范化设计,以减少数据冗余和提高数据一致性。

(三)索引优化

索引是提高数据库查询性能的关键,正确地创建和使用索引可以显著减少查询时间,索引也会占用一定的存储空间,并可能影响数据的插入和更新性能,在创建索引时,应根据实际需求和数据特点进行权衡,定期分析和优化索引,以保持其最佳性能。

(四)查询优化

编写高效的SQL查询语句是提高数据库性能的关键,避免使用复杂的连接查询和子查询,尽量使用简单的单表查询,合理使用事务和锁机制,以确保数据的一致性和完整性,对于高频执行的查询,可以考虑将其缓存在内存或使用专门的查询缓存系统。

(五)数据库参数调优

数据库参数的调优可以显著提升其性能,针对具体的数据库管理系统(如MySQL、PostgreSQL等),可以通过编辑配置文件或使用管理工具来调整参数设置,调整缓存大小、连接数限制等参数,以适应应用的实际需求,调优过程中应逐步进行,并监控性能变化以确保调整的效果。

(六)备份与恢复策略

合理的备份与恢复策略可以确保数据库在发生故障时能够迅速恢复到正常状态,定期备份数据库,并测试备份数据的完整性和可恢复性,制定详细的恢复计划,明确恢复步骤和时间要求,以便在紧急情况下快速响应。

云服务器与数据库的配置优化是一项复杂而关键的任务,它直接关系到应用的整体性能和稳定性,通过合理选择云服务提供商与实例类型、精确配置服务器资源、优化网络连接以及完善安全防护措施等措施,可以显著提升云服务器的性能表现;而通过精心设计数据库架构、合理利用索引、优化查询语句以及调整数据库参数等一系列策略,可以大幅增强数据库的稳定性和数据处理能力,随着技术的不断发展和应用场景的不断演变,我们也需要持续关注新的优化技术和方法,以便及时更新和完善云服务器与数据库的配置方案,我们期待看到更多创新的云原生技术和智能化管理系统出现,以进一步提升云计算生态系统的整体性能和稳定性。